My 2021 Makeup Spending Goals

This year, I want to keep my buying under control. I have many other things going on in my life and while makeup is a great passion of mine, I do want to focus my energy on using the makeup I have. I do not plan on going on a no buy but I am considering a low buy. If nothing else, there are specific categories within my makeup collection I will absolutely be doing a low buy in.

The first category, is highlighters. I have so many highlighters and while I absolutely love highlighters, I have way more then I can use. If I am so add another highlighter to my collection, it will have to be something special, either a formula I have never tried, or something that is completely unique to my collection.

The next category is eyeshadow palettes. While I know my love for eyeshadow palettes will prevent me from a complete no buy this year, this is another category I have a ton of an don’t NEED to add more. I do however collect certain palettes, so if more release in that line, I already know I will be adding those to my collection. So my ultimate goal is to limit any other additions to my collection to truly unique palettes.

Now we are getting into the no buy categories. I would like to start with liquid lipstick. I never wear liquid lipstick any more and I have no need to add more to my collection. I have struggled with admitting to myself that this is the case, but it is important to remember that just because others are a fan of a formula or a product does not mean you have to be. My preferred lip color formula is stick lipstick, so I have no need for other formulas. This will actually include my second category.

I have no interest in buying more lip gloss formula. I have a few lip glosses in my collection that I do enjoy and I have back ups of those products so there’s no need to add more to my collection especially since I hardly wear them.

The other makeup products that fall under the “I have enough for now and therefore shouldn’t purchase more” category include setting sprays, bronzers and face palettes. I have several of each of these and therefore wish to get use out of the products I have already purchased.
